Timmonsville, SC - Carl Ray Watford Jr.,68, left this world suddenly May 7, 2021. He was well known as a caring son, brother, husband, father, grandfather and friend.
A graveside service will be Monday, May 10, 2021 at 11:00 a.m. at Salem United Methodist Cemetery in Timmonsville, SC. The family will speak to those attending after the service.
Ray was born in Florence County, the son of Annie Jo Harrell Watford and the late Carl Ray Watford, Sr. Ray graduated from Timmonsville High School in 1970. There, he met and married his high school sweetheart, Marsha Hammond McElveen. They were married December 23, 1971 and spent their life together at their home and farm in Timmonsville, South Carolina.
Ray's greatest passion in life was spending time with his family which usually involved carefully selecting something to cook, BBQ, or smoke for watching Clemson football or the Atlanta Braves games, and or Sunday dinner. He passed along his love for cooking to his son, Chris. Ray thought his daughter, Ashley Watford Watson & her three children could do no wrong. He derived the most joy from spending time with each of them. Ray loved attending the football games or even practice of his eldest grandchild, Peyton Eric Watson. He attended countless baseball games with his "special rocking chair" of the middle grandchild, Parker James Watson. Ray spent time with the youngest grandchild, Raegan Claire, planting the garden and raising chickens on the farm.
Ray is survived by his mother, Annie Jo Watford; his wife, Marsha Watford; son, Christopher Ray Watford; daughter, Ashley & son in law, Eric Watson; grandchildren, Peyton, Parker, & Raegan Claire Watson; two sisters; Janice (Mike) Ward and Donna (Ben) Lynch; many nieces and nephews who he all adored.
